Window Replacement

Window replacements are a great way of improving energy efficiency while also reducing noise and enhancing security. It is important to consult with a reputable supplier or service provider to ensure that the new windows are of top quality, well-sized and properly installed. This will increase the value of your investment and allow you to achieve the best results. Additionally replacement windows are an ideal option for older homes with dated single pane windows that do not adequately insulate or block UV radiation.

Replacement of your window glass is among the most cost-effective methods to upgrade your home's insulation and efficiency. New upvc window repairs near me and wooden frames provide superior insulation against cold, wind, and rain, while double-glazed units with low-emissivity (low-e) coatings and argon gas fillings reduce heat transfer, resulting in lower energy costs. The best double-paned windows also acoustically-insulated and have multi-point locking mechanisms that provide increased security.

Replacing a single pane of double-glazed windows costs between PS55 to PS145 per pane, based on the size and shape of the upvc window repair. However, it's generally cheaper to repair a blown window, and it's vital to have a professional evaluation of the situation and advice before you decide whether to replace or repair your windows.

If your double-glazed windows appear cloudy it could be a sign of a leak or a problem with the seal. A specialized repair procedure can be utilized to eliminate the moisture and clean the glass unit, and Window Repairs Near Me then install a new spacer bar and a desiccant in order to prevent future condensation. This repair can be done at home or in a shop and is typically less expensive than replacing the entire window.

Replacing a damaged double-pane is the most cost-effective solution however, it's not always feasible to replace only the glass. Double-pane windows have a gap between the two glass panes, which is sealed with argon gas or krypton gas to create an airtight seal, which reduces energy loss. In order to maintain energy efficiency, and to ensure an airtight seal it is typically required to replace the entire window if a single glass pane breaks.

Misted Double Glazing

Double glazing that is stained could pose a risk to homeowners. It can affect the way your windows function, and can lead to dampness, mould and expensive energy bills. It's important to fix any issues with double glazing promptly, especially as winter approaches.

When the glass of your windows is prone to condensation between the panes, it is known as misting. It is usually caused by poor installation or air infiltration. The best method to avoid this is to utilize a FENSA approved window installer.

Keep your double glazing clear of dirt, dust and other debris. The frames can be cleaned using soapy water and warm water. However, if the frames are made of aluminium or wood and you're not sure, look at other methods of cleaning them thoroughly.

Double glazing owners frequently report that their doors and windows are difficult to open or close after installation. Extreme temperatures can cause the frame to expand or contract based on the weather. You can try to adjust the hinges, handles, and mechanisms by using hot or cold water. If this fails, you might think about contact the company who installed your double glazing as they might offer a refund or repair service.

If your double-glazed windows are beginning to fog this could indicate that the seal in between the two panes of glass has failed. This can be due to a variety of factors, including poor installation, age, or harsh chemicals or oil-based cleaners. It's also a good idea to choose an FENSA regulated installer to ensure that your double glazing is in full compliance with UK building regulations.

In certain instances you can fix a misted double-glazing unit by replacing the spacer bars with ones that are a little warmer. This will increase the temperature of the glass, which will help to stop condensation. You can also use thermally efficient glasses that have coatings that emit low emissions, and argon between the glass to minimize condensation.

Window Repair

Double-paned windows can be a great way to protect your home from the elements and increase the efficiency of your HVAC system. However, windows do develop issues with time, so it's important to know when to repair or replace them.

If you notice a build-up of dirt, fogging, or moisture it could be a sign that the seal of your window has failed. The seals prevent air from getting out of the two panes that make up your IGU. (IGU).

This could result in your window becoming less energy efficient and resulting in higher utility bills. Depending on how serious the issue is, you may need to replace the entire window or only the glass.

In certain situations a professional may be able to perform an effective window repair to fix the problem. It may be necessary to clean the area, replace the seal, or apply a little putty or silicone. This will stop the seal from splintering and will allow you to utilize your window as normal.

Window replacements are more costly than window repairs, but it is crucial to weigh your options before making the decision. You'll need to consider the condition of your existing frame, the cost of the repairs and whether you want an updated look or more insulation from the outdoors.

You can upgrade your windows with new components such as hinges, handles or sash cords. These upgrades will make your windows more secure and safe and also more user-friendly. Window screens can also get torn or damaged, allowing insects into your living space. Replacing your window screens will ensure your home is free of pests and create a cleaner and safer environment.

The window frame is an essential part of the overall window structure, holding the glass panels in place. The frames are made from aluminum, wood or vinyl, and they can be damaged, rotted, or cracked from weather or sunlight exposure. Window moldings can also become worn out and requires to be replaced or repaired. Generally speaking, wooden frames are more costly to repair and replace than aluminum or vinyl, and the price will vary depending on the type of material used and the extent of damage.

Skylight Repair

Skylights are an excellent way to let natural light into a home without creating a bright. They also work well for adding insulation which can reduce heating costs. Like any window or door they can experience a variety problems. If a double-pane skylight is damaged, it's important to call in an expert to repair it as soon as you can. This will prevent condensation, water leaks and other damage to the glass and frame.

Skylight leaks are typically caused by the deterioration of the glazing seal, or the frame corrosion. These problems can result in the frame leaking water and into the ceiling. A professional can fix a skylight that is leaking by sealing or replacing the flashing seal, and frame. The cost to repair a skylight varies depending on the size of the window and type of glass. It might be worth replacing the entire frame if severely damaged.

Mold is another problem that is commonly encountered with skylights. Mold can appear on the outside, inside or the frame of the skylight. The cause of the mold may be due to a water leak or condensation or an improper sealing. If the mold is limited to the area around the window, then simple repairs can be made. If the mold is widespread, the skylight may require replacement.
